Peppermint
Mentha piperita
Cooling digestive herb with a refreshing flavor
Strong evidenceAbout Peppermint
Peppermint is a natural hybrid of watermint and spearmint, prized for its high menthol content and refreshing properties. It has been used for centuries to support digestive comfort and provide a cooling sensation that may help ease tension.
Key benefits
- May help soothe digestive discomfort and ease bloating
- Traditionally used to support respiratory comfort
- Known for its cooling, refreshing properties
- May help promote mental clarity and focus
How to use
Brew fresh or dried leaves as tea by steeping in hot water for 5-7 minutes, or use diluted peppermint oil topically for a cooling sensation.
Did you know?
Peppermint didn't exist in the wild until the 17th century—it's a sterile hybrid that can only reproduce through cuttings, making every peppermint plant essentially a clone.
